| I booked the flight from Bangkok to Siem Reap online at http://www.bangkokair.com/en/. In most cases, it's cheaper than going through agencies. Note though that it is a budget airline, but they speak good english. On my last trip, there were a lot of foreigners on the flight. |

| hey i went to angkor on my gap year. i went to thailand first though so went across the land border which during the summer i wouldnt advise. the border there is err... interesting. hard to get through without being scammed and with backpacks you bake in nice outdoor waits. haha but def an exp. we managed to convince a van to take us from cambodia side border to siem reap. the roads suck and we broke down twice. looking back was pretty comic (the guy stored water in the front to chuck onto the engine when it overheated). |
